Informal contractions are short forms of other words that people use when speaking casually. They are not exactly slang, but they are a little like slang. For example, "gonna" is a short form of "going to". If you say going to very fast, without carefully pronouncing each word, it can sound like gonna.Gonna, gotta and wanna are not contractions. Contractions are shortenings like aren’t and can’t. The missing letters have been replaced by an apostrophe, and the original words are discernible in the contraction. Contractions are acceptable in all but the most formal writing. That’s how we say that verb in casual, spoken English. A whole syllable disappears! It happens, especially when talking fast. Going to. "Gonna" is a shortening of "going to". "Gunna" is a misspelling based on how "gonna" is pronounced. You may also see "finna" both written and spoken, and it essentially means "going to" as well. "Finna" is a shortening of "fixing to" which is a replacement for "going to" in dialects of the American South. The first problem, as discussed here, here, and here, is that there ... Gotta, gonna, and wanna are common informal words used in writing to represent rapid speech. Gotta means "got to," gonna means "going to," and wanna means "want to." Here are some additional pronunciation spellings you may see or hear: dunno = don't know. gotcha = got you. lemme = let me. gimme = give me. Gonna, the colloquial abbreviation of going to, has been around for hundreds of years and is present in virtually every variety of English, but it has never gained acceptance in serious writing.
